golang如何安装php插件

发布时间:2024-07-05 00:58:14

在Golang开发领域,有时会遇到需要使用PHP插件的情况,例如与已有的PHP项目集成、调用PHP库等。本文将介绍如何在Golang中安装PHP插件。

选择合适的PHP插件

在开始安装之前,首先要选择一个适合的PHP插件。Golang提供了许多与PHP集成的插件,可以根据具体需求选择。一些常用的插件包括go-php、php-go等。这些插件可以帮助Golang与PHP之间进行数据传递、调用PHP函数等操作。

安装PHP插件

安装PHP插件通常需要依赖一些PHP运行环境和工具。下面是一些常见的安装步骤:

1. 首先,确认系统中已经安装了PHP解释器,并且将PHP的可执行文件添加到系统的PATH环境变量中。这样才能在终端中运行PHP命令。

2. 接下来,安装PHP扩展管理工具Composer。Composer是一个用于管理PHP包和依赖关系的工具,非常方便。你可以从Composer官方网站上下载安装包并按照提示进行安装。

3. 在安装Composer后,打开终端,使用Composer安装适合你的PHP插件。通常,你只需要在终端中运行一个简单的命令,Composer就会自动下载并安装PHP插件及其依赖。

配置Golang项目

安装完PHP插件后,还需要进行一些配置才能在Golang项目中使用。以下是配置步骤:

1. 在Golang项目的import语句中导入所需的PHP插件。例如,如果你选择了go-php插件,则在代码文件的开头添加以下导入语句:

import "github.com/deuill/go-php"

2. 在Golang项目的main函数或其他需要使用PHP插件的函数中,调用相应的PHP函数。这些函数可以直接从插件的文档中获得,并按照其特定的参数和返回值进行调用。

3. 在编译或运行Golang项目时,确保系统可以正确找到PHP的可执行文件。如果遇到找不到PHP解释器的问题,请检查系统的环境变量设置是否正确。

至此,PHP插件的安装和配置就完成了。现在,你可以在Golang项目中使用PHP插件提供的功能了。无论是与已有的PHP项目集成,还是调用PHP库,都可以借助这些插件来实现。

相关推荐